32nd round: Goal drought in France © EuroFootball.com

Over the weekend, eight matches of the 32nd round of the highest French football division "Ligue 1" were played, six of which ended in goalless draws.

Recently struggling yet still fighting for European spots, the "Lens" club lost another two points. This time they met with the league's outsider "Nantes" and failed to beat them - the match ended in a 0-0 draw.

The "Toulouse" team, showing excellent form, took advantage of "Lens'" stumble, defeating "Auxerre" 2-0 and securing the second place in the standings. "Toulouse" took the lead in the 6th minute when Achille Emana scored, and Fode Mansare doubled the lead after half an hour. This victory not only allowed the Toulouse team to maintain the second position but also prevented the "Lyon" club from securing the "Ligue 1" champions title in this round.

In the same scoreline, the "Lille" club also won on Saturday, strengthening their hopes to compete in the UEFA Champions League next season by defeating "Sochaux" at home. The goals for the winners were scored by Nicolas Fauvergue in the 50th and Kevin Mirallas in the 66th minute.

Paris's "P.S.G" club continues to dangerously balance near the relegation zone. In this round, the Parisians ended their match against last season's vice-champion "Bordeaux" team in a goalless draw and currently occupy the 16th place in the league, barely three points ahead of the relegation zone team "Troyes".
